Court Date Set For Carroll Man Accused Of Felony Burglary

The court date for a Carroll man facing burglary charges has been scheduled for next week. Fifty-four-year-old Randall Joseph Woodward will appear in District Court for Carroll County on Tuesday, Jan. 9. He has been charged with third-degree burglary, a class D felony, stemming from an incident on July 13 in which Woodward is accused of taking items from an apartment on East 3rd Street. Woodward claims he was only collecting his property taken from his residence by the victim. The case will be tried as a bench trial, as Woodward has waived his right to a jury. If found guilty of the charge, Woodward faces up to five years in prison and a maximum fine of $7,500.
